NDB_No Description Weight (g) Common Measure  Content per Measure
Vitamin B-12 (μg) Content of Selected Foods per Common Measure,  sorted by nutrient content

15160 Mollusks, clam, mixed species, canned, drained solids 85 3 oz 84.06
13327 Beef, variety meats and by-products, liver, cooked, pan-fried 85 3 oz 70.66
05172 Turkey, all classes, giblets, cooked, simmered, some giblet fat 145 1 cup 48.21
15157 Mollusks, clam, mixed species, raw 85 3 oz 42.02
15167 Mollusks, oyster, eastern, wild, raw 84 6 medium 16.35
05022 Chicken, broilers or fryers, giblets, cooked, simmered 145 1 cup 13.69
15168 Mollusks, oyster, eastern, cooked, breaded and fried 85 3 oz 13.29
06230 Soup, clam chowder, new england, canned, prepared with equal volume low fat (2%) milk 248 1 cup 11.90
07014 Braunschweiger (a liver sausage), pork 56.7 2 slices 11.39
15137 Crustaceans, crab, alaska king, cooked, moist heat 85 3 oz 9.78
15086 Fish, salmon, sockeye, cooked, dry heat 155 1/2 fillet 8.99
22120 MORNINGSTAR FARMS Grillers Recipe Crumbles, frozen, unprepared 110 1 cup 8.91
15088 Fish, sardine, Atlantic, canned in oil, drained solids with bone 85.05 3 oz 7.60
15140 Crustaceans, crab, blue, cooked, moist heat 85 3 oz 6.21
08067 Cereals ready-to-eat, KELLOGG, KELLOGG'S SPECIAL K 31 1 cup 6.05
08028 Cereals ready-to-eat, KELLOGG, KELLOGG'S ALL-BRAN COMPLETE Wheat Flakes 29 3/4 cup 6.00
08247 Cereals ready-to-eat, GENERAL MILLS, TOTAL Raisin Bran 55 1 cup 6.00
08058 Cereals ready-to-eat, KELLOGG, KELLOGG'S PRODUCT 19 30 1 cup 6.00
08077 Cereals ready-to-eat, GENERAL MILLS, Whole Grain TOTAL 30 3/4 cup 6.00
08246 Cereals ready-to-eat, GENERAL MILLS, TOTAL Corn Flakes 30 1-1/3 cup 6.00
08001 Cereals ready-to-eat, KELLOGG, KELLOGG'S ALL-BRAN Original 30 1/2 cup 5.64
15086 Fish, salmon, sockeye, cooked, dry heat 85 3 oz 4.93
15241 Fish, trout, rainbow, farmed, cooked, dry heat 85 3 oz 4.22
21114 Fast foods, hamburger; double, large patty; with condiments and vegetables 226 1 sandwich 4.07
06428 Soup, clam chowder, manhattan, canned, prepared with equal volume water 244 1 cup 3.86
15084 Fish, salmon, pink, canned, solids with bone and liquid 85 3 oz 3.74
15041 Fish, herring, Atlantic, pickled 85.05 3 oz 3.63
15067 Fish, pollock, walleye, cooked, dry heat 85 3 oz 3.57
15142 Crustaceans, crab, blue, crab cakes 60 1 cake 3.56
21111 Fast foods, hamburger; double, regular patty; with condiments 215 1 sandwich 3.33
05028 Chicken, liver, all classes, cooked, simmered 19.6 1 liver 3.30
15029 Fish, flatfish (flounder and sole species), cooked, dry heat 127 1 fillet 3.19
08065 Cereals ready-to-eat, KELLOGG, KELLOGG'S RICE KRISPIES 33 1-1/4 cup 3.13
08060 Cereals ready-to-eat, KELLOGG, KELLOGG'S RAISIN BRAN 61 1 cup 3.12
08089 Cereals ready-to-eat, GENERAL MILLS, WHEATIES 30 1 cup 3.00
15077 Fish, salmon, chinook, smoked 85.05 3 oz 2.77
08020 Cereals ready-to-eat, KELLOGG, KELLOGG'S Corn Flakes 28 1 cup 2.65
15148 Crustaceans, lobster, northern, cooked, moist heat 85 3 oz 2.64
15121 Fish, tuna, light, canned in water, drained solids 85 3 oz 2.54
15067 Fish, pollock, walleye, cooked, dry heat 60 1 fillet 2.52
08069 Cereals ready-to-eat, KELLOGG, KELLOGG'S FROSTED FLAKES 31 3/4 cup 2.48
15128 Fish, tuna salad 205 1 cup 2.46
21097 Fast foods, cheeseburger; single, large patty; with condiments and bacon 195 1 sandwich 2.44
23578 Beef, ground, 75% lean meat / 25% fat, patty, cooked, broiled 85 3 oz 2.39
21113 Fast foods, hamburger; single, large patty; with condiments and vegetables 218 1 sandwich 2.38

Cited from USDA National Nutrient Database for Standard Reference, Release 21

originally published at  http://www.nal.usda.gov/fnic/foodcomp/Data/SR21/nutrlist/sr21w418.pdf
